What is the Wire Transfer Authorization Form?
The Wire Transfer Authorization Form is a critical document utilized by members of FRB Federal Credit Union (FRBFCU) to authorize and provide detailed instructions for wire transfers. This form facilitates the secure execution of wire transfers by capturing essential information such as the sender’s and recipient’s financial institution details, beneficiary name, and transfer purpose. Updated as of December 2024, this form ensures that the authorization is clear and legally binding.

How to fill out the Wire Transfer Form
-
1.To begin, access the Wire Transfer Authorization Form on pdfFiller by browsing the forms library or searching using the form name.
-
2.Once the form is open, familiarize yourself with the fillable fields provided in the interface.
-
3.Before completing the form, gather all necessary information, including details about the sender's and recipient's financial institutions, beneficiary information, and the amount to be transferred.
-
4.Start filling in the required fields, ensuring to input accurate information for 'Name:', 'Daytime Phone #:', 'Purpose of Wire:', and 'Email Address for Notifications:'.
-
5.Next, provide the sender's and recipient’s financial institution details including 'FI Name:', 'FI Number:', and any necessary international details such as 'IBAN:' or 'Swift Code.'
-
6.Continue by filling in beneficiary information, including 'Beneficiary Name:', 'Account #:', and any optional instructions under 'Optional Originator to Beneficiary Instructions:'.
-
7.Make sure to review the form for completeness before signing. Confirm that your 'Member Signature:' and 'Date:' fields are filled in correctly.
-
8.Utilize pdfFiller's tools to check your entries and ensure that all required fields are completed properly.
-
9.Once finalized, save the completed form using pdfFiller’s save or download options. You can also directly submit the form via email or as specified by your financial institution.
Who is eligible to fill out the Wire Transfer Authorization Form?
Eligibility to fill out the Wire Transfer Authorization Form includes members of FRB Federal Credit Union who are authorized to initiate wire transfers on their accounts.
What information do I need to complete the form?
You will need sender and recipient financial institution details, beneficiary information, the amount to be transferred, and any specific instructions that may apply to the transaction.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ing the form, you can save it for your records, download it, and then submit it as directed by your financial institution, which may include in-person delivery or secure email.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all financial institution details are accurate, double-check names and account numbers for typos, and confirm the purpose of the wire is clearly stated to prevent delays.
Are there any fees associated with wire transfers?
Yes, wire transfers typically incur fees that vary based on the financial institution and the type of transfer. It's best to check with FRB Federal Credit Union for specific fee details.
What are the processing times for wire transfers?
Processing times can differ. Domestic wire transfers are usually completed on the same day, while international transfers may take one to five business days, depending on the institutions involved.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, the Wire Transfer Authorization Form does not require notarization. However, a valid member signature is necessary for transaction authorization.
